The Seven Works of Mercy: A Masterpiece of Baroque Art

Understanding Caravaggio's Artistic Vision

The Influence of Naturalism in Caravaggio's Work

Caravaggio, a pioneer of Baroque art, embraced naturalism, which emphasized realistic human figures and settings. His approach brought a fresh perspective to religious themes, making them relatable to everyday life. This technique allowed viewers to connect deeply with the subjects, as they appeared more like ordinary people than distant saints.

Exploring the Dramatic Use of Light and Shadow

One of Caravaggio's signature techniques is chiaroscuro, the dramatic contrast between light and dark. In "The Seven Works of Mercy," he masterfully uses this technique to highlight the emotional intensity of the scene. The light draws attention to the figures performing acts of mercy, creating a powerful visual narrative that captivates the viewer.

Symbolism and Themes in The Seven Works of Mercy

Mercy and Compassion: The Core Message of the Painting

At its heart, "The Seven Works of Mercy" conveys a profound message of mercy and compassion. Each act depicted in the painting serves as a reminder of the importance of kindness in human interactions. Caravaggio's portrayal encourages viewers to reflect on their own capacity for empathy and altruism.

Religious Significance: The Seven Corporal Works of Mercy

The painting illustrates the Seven Corporal Works of Mercy, which are essential teachings in Christian doctrine. These acts include feeding the hungry, giving drink to the thirsty, and visiting the sick. Caravaggio's choice to depict these themes emphasizes the moral responsibility of individuals to care for one another, reinforcing the painting's spiritual significance.

Human Emotion: Capturing the Essence of Humanity

Caravaggio's ability to capture raw human emotion is evident in "The Seven Works of Mercy." The expressions and gestures of the figures convey a range of feelings, from compassion to sorrow. This emotional depth invites viewers to engage with the painting on a personal level, making it a timeless reflection of the human experience.

Detailed Analysis of The Seven Works of Mercy Composition

Color Palette: The Rich Hues of Baroque Painting

The color palette in "The Seven Works of Mercy" features rich, deep hues typical of Baroque painting. Caravaggio uses warm tones to create a sense of intimacy and urgency. The vibrant reds, earthy browns, and soft skin tones enhance the emotional impact of the scene, drawing the viewer into the narrative.

Figures and Gestures: A Study of Movement and Emotion

The figures in the painting are arranged dynamically, with gestures that convey action and emotion. Each character's pose contributes to the overall sense of movement, as if the scene is unfolding in real time. This technique not only captures the viewer's attention but also emphasizes the importance of each act of mercy being performed.

Spatial Arrangement: The Interaction of Characters

Caravaggio's spatial arrangement in "The Seven Works of Mercy" creates a sense of depth and interaction among the characters. The figures are positioned in a way that suggests a shared experience, inviting the viewer to witness the acts of mercy as they happen. This thoughtful composition enhances the narrative and emotional resonance of the painting.

The Historical Context of The Seven Works of Mercy

Caravaggio's Life: A Glimpse into the Artist's Turbulent Times

Caravaggio lived a tumultuous life marked by conflict and controversy. His experiences shaped his art, infusing it with a sense of realism and urgency. The societal challenges of his time, including poverty and crime, influenced his choice of subjects, making his works resonate with contemporary audiences.

The Role of Patronage in Baroque Art: Who Commissioned the Work?

"The Seven Works of Mercy" was commissioned by the Confraternity of the Pious Works of Mercy in Naples. This patronage reflects the importance of charitable organizations during the Baroque period. The painting served not only as a work of art but also as a visual representation of the confraternity's mission to promote acts of kindness.

Artistic Trends: How The Seven Works of Mercy Reflects Its Era

Caravaggio's work embodies the Baroque era's emphasis on emotional intensity and realism. His innovative techniques and themes set him apart from his contemporaries. "The Seven Works of Mercy" exemplifies the era's focus on spirituality and the human condition, making it a significant contribution to Baroque art.

Comparative Analysis: Caravaggio vs. His Contemporaries

Contrasting Styles: Caravaggio and the Venetian Masters

While Venetian masters like Titian favored vibrant colors and idealized forms, Caravaggio's style was grounded in realism. His focus on everyday life and emotional depth contrasts sharply with the more decorative approach of his contemporaries. This distinction highlights Caravaggio's unique contribution to the art world.

Influence on Future Generations: The Legacy of Caravaggio's Techniques

Caravaggio's innovative techniques influenced countless artists, paving the way for the Baroque movement and beyond. His use of chiaroscuro and naturalism inspired generations of painters, including Rembrandt and Velázquez. The legacy of his work continues to be felt in modern art, where emotional expression remains a vital element.

FAQs About The Seven Works of Mercy

What are the Seven Works of Mercy depicted in the painting?

The painting illustrates the Seven Corporal Works of Mercy: feeding the hungry, giving drink to the thirsty, clothing the naked, visiting the sick, visiting the imprisoned, burying the dead, and giving alms to the poor.

How did Caravaggio's life influence his artwork?

Caravaggio's tumultuous life, marked by violence and personal struggles, influenced his art by infusing it with raw emotion and realism. His experiences allowed him to portray the human condition authentically.

What techniques did Caravaggio use to create depth in this painting?

Caravaggio employed chiaroscuro to create depth, using strong contrasts between light and shadow. This technique enhances the three-dimensionality of the figures and draws attention to the central actions.

Why is The Seven Works of Mercy considered a significant work of art?

"The Seven Works of Mercy" is significant for its emotional depth, innovative use of light, and its powerful message of compassion. It reflects the core values of the Baroque period and Caravaggio's unique artistic vision.

What is the historical significance of the painting's subject matter?

The subject matter highlights the importance of mercy and charity in Christian teachings. It serves as a visual reminder of the moral obligations individuals have towards one another, making it a timeless piece of art.

How does The Seven Works of Mercy compare to other works by Caravaggio?

Compared to other works by Caravaggio, "The Seven Works of Mercy" stands out for its complex composition and emotional narrative. It showcases his mastery of light and shadow while addressing themes of compassion and humanity.
